    Chuck Hicks to Serve as EVP, CFO, Treasurer at NCI

    By Jenny LondonJuly 16, 2019
    Share
    LinkedIn Facebook Twitter Email
    Chuck Hicks, NCI

    Charles “Chuck” Hicks Jr. has come on board NCI Information Systems, Inc. as executive vice president, chief financial officer and treasurer.

    With over 25 years’ industry experience, his expertise includes M&A transactions; integration initiatives to improve operational excellence, efficiency and performance; and the development of strategic partnerships. 

    “Chuck is a well-known change agent and a highly respected finance/business leader in the GovCon market,” said NCI President and CEO Paul Dillahay. “He has a stellar track record of driving financial operational excellence and will be integral in helping shape our decision making as we continue to execute on our growth strategy.”

    Prior to joining NCI, Hicks was CFO for Cresa Global, Inc. Before this, he served as EVP for strategic growth, as as chief operating officer and CFO for SC3. In addition to these roles, Hicks held executive leadership roles at ASRC Federal, SAIC and USIS.

    Hicks said he was honored to be part of the company’ senior leadership team.

    “This is an exciting time for our company, as we partner with our federal customers to help advance their mission utilizing emerging technologies and innovative solutions such as artificial intelligence, advanced data analytics and agile software development,” he added.

    Hicks served in the U.S. Navy and has a bachelor’s degree in accounting from the University of Maryland College Park. In addition, he completed the executive M&A education from the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ania.
